Het Oude Raadhuis, located in the heart of Oud-Beijerland, serves as a vibrant library offering a broad collection of books and resources for all ages. Visitors can also enjoy a cozy lunchroom, De Waterstal, for refreshments while engaging in various activities available on-site.
The library emphasizes the importance of reading and language development, providing supportive programs for babies and young children. It features a dedicated Maak Lokaal space equipped with interesting devices for creative projects, fostering community engagement through arts and crafts.
